Scott CX Comp bike review

Scott produced the CX Comp bike in 2009 and can be classified as a Cyclo-cross bicycle, this exact model costs in american market arround $1,494.99.
CX Comp bike is available in many sizes such as Xsmall , small , medium , large and xlarge .
Scott Cyclo-cross CX Comp can be found in a few colors, among these colors Black and White and Gold .
This bike is equiped with 700 x 35c Continental Speed King CX tires and DT Swiss stainless spoke wheel while the rims are manufactured by Mavic CXP 22, 32-hole. Scott equiped this exact model with Tektro CX Carbon brakes, Shimano Tiagra STI levers braking system and Front: Scott SCO 31, Rear: Shimano Tiagra hubs.
